Product Description

The ADIC 96-5387-03 is a specialized hardware bridge designed to connect systems utilizing Fibre Channel interfaces with devices or controllers that use VHDCI SCSI LVD (Low Voltage Differential) interfaces. In storage area networks (SANs) or complex data center environments, there is often a need to integrate equipment with different connectivity standards. This bridge serves precisely that purpose, allowing for interoperability between Fibre Channel storage arrays, servers, or switches and SCSI-based peripherals or controllers. With two Fibre Channel ports, the bridge can connect to the high-speed fabric of a Fibre Channel SAN. On the other side, it provides four VHDCI SCSI LVD ports, which are commonly used for connecting high-performance SCSI devices such as disk drives, tape libraries, or RAID controllers. The bridge performs the necessary protocol translation and signal conversion to enable communication between these disparate interfaces, ensuring that data can flow seamlessly. This type of device is typically used during technology migrations, in environments where mixed storage technologies are present, or for specific connectivity requirements within a data center. The ADIC 96-5387-03 is engineered to provide reliable and efficient data transfer between Fibre Channel and SCSI LVD environments, supporting the demands of enterprise storage solutions.
